Why is This Prediction Reasonable?

Detailed mechanism-of-action data for this evidence pack is flagged as a data gap. Based on known pharmacology, valsartan is an angiotensin II type 1 (AT1) receptor blocker used to treat hypertension; mechanistically, RAAS (renin-angiotensin-aldosterone system) blockade could plausibly extend to blood-pressure-driven renal injury states.

The predicted indication, malignant hypertensive renal disease, overlaps mechanistically with renal blood-pressure regulation and RAAS overactivation — AT1 blockade could theoretically reduce intraglomerular pressure and slow renal damage. However, the only supporting literature (PMID 24368192) studies avosentan, an endothelin receptor antagonist, not valsartan itself. This is cross-drug-class indirect evidence — mechanistically relevant, but not direct evidence for valsartan.

Notably, a closely related predicted indication in this same evidence pack, malignant renovascular hypertension (tied top TxGNN score), is supported by more directly relevant evidence: PMID 11560862 shows that AT1 receptor blockade prevents lethal malignant hypertension and protects the kidney in an animal model — an on-target class effect consistent with valsartan’s known mechanism, though the study is dated (2001) and presumed preclinical rather than a human trial. This strengthens the overall mechanistic plausibility of AT1 blockade in malignant hypertensive/renovascular disease states, even though direct valsartan-specific evidence for either indication is still lacking.
